Tactilis Posted July 2 Share Posted July 2 2 hours ago, ontherun said: I am aware, return to mouse pointer after using paint.net tools has been an issue for a while. It is not an issue. There is no 'mouse pointer' to return to in the way that you describe; there never has been. One of the tools is always active and the appropriate pointer is displayed. As @toe_head2001 suggests, you can use the Pan tool. You can even set that to be the default tool. See Settings > Tools here https://www.getpaint.net/doc/latest/SettingsDialog.html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
